Attending a Thai wedding is a wonderful way to experience local customs, but it’s essential to adhere to certain etiquette. First, it's customary to dress modestly and elegantly, often leaning towards traditional attire if possible. - Bringing a small gift, such as money in an envelope, is a common practice to help the couple start their new life together. The amount can vary, but it's more about the gesture than the sum. - During the ceremony, be respectful and attentive, as many rituals hold significant cultural meaning. Observing quietly and participating when invited can show your respect for their traditions.
